- Abstract
- In recent years, for the need of meaning, Chinese language has absorbed a large number of foreign scientific and technological concepts and things. As a result, many scientific and technological loanwords have been produced. To better understand the rules of this absorption process, it is crucial to analyze the characteristics of scientific and technological loanwords.
This paper conducts a quantitative analysis of scientific and technological loanwords from 2006 to 2018 based on the books 『Hanyuxinciyu』 series. The premise of the quantitative analysis is to define the scope of research objects and establish an independent database. Therefore, this paper is mainly divided into two parts. First part is to define the scientific and technological loanwords. Second part is to find the corresponding words and to analyze their characteristics. The analysis of loanwords focus on four aspects - content, structure, borrowing and use condition. With this analysis, we can better understand the science & cultural exchanges between China and other countries, as well as the future trends.
